Acadian Timber (ADN) Set to Announce Quarterly Earnings on Wednesday

Acadian Timber (TSE:ADN - Get Free Report) is set to post its quarterly earnings results after the market closes on Wednesday, May 8th.

Acadian Timber (TSE:ADN -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 7th. The company reported C$0.08 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of C$0.16 by C($0.08). Acadian Timber had a return on equity of 9.45% and a net margin of 31.49%. The firm had revenue of C$23.82 million during the quarter.

Acadian Timber Company Profile

Acadian Timber Corp. supplies primary forest products in Eastern Canada and the Northeastern United States. The company operates in two segments, NB Timberlands and Maine Timberlands. Its products include softwood and hardwood sawlogs, pulpwood, and biomass by-products. The company owns and manages freehold timberlands in New Brunswick and Maine; and provides timber services relating to Crown licensed timberlands in New Brunswick.
